Cave of The Winds
Description
Explore caves and walkways near Niagara Falls for an exciting and interactive outdoor adventure for families.
Details
Address
332 Prospect St Niagara Falls, NY 14303
Phone
Location
332 Prospect St Niagara Falls, NY 14303
Review
Write a ReviewThere are no reviews yet.